package icmpping
import (
"bytes"
"encoding/binary"
"iochen.com/v2gen/app/ping"
"iochen.com/v2gen/infra/vmess"
"log"
"net"
"time"
)
type icmp struct {
Type uint8
Code uint8
CheckSum uint16
Identifier uint16
SequenceNum uint16
}
func getICMP() (*icmp, error) {
icmp := &icmp{Type: 8}
var buffer bytes.Buffer
if err := binary.Write(&buffer, binary.BigEndian, *icmp); err != nil {
return nil, err
}
icmp.CheckSum = checkSum(buffer.Bytes())
buffer.Reset()
return icmp, nil
}
func sendICMPRequest(icmp *icmp, ip *net.IPAddr, timeout time.Duration) (time.Duration, error) {
conn, err := net.DialIP("ip4:icmp", nil, ip)
if err != nil {
return -1, err
}
defer func() {
err = conn.Close()
if err != nil {
log.Println(err)
}
}()
var buffer bytes.Buffer
if err = binary.Write(&buffer, binary.BigEndian, icmp); err != nil {
return -1, err
}
if _, err := conn.Write(buffer.Bytes()); err != nil {
return -1, err
}
start := time.Now()
if err = conn.SetReadDeadline(time.Now().Add(time.Second * timeout)); err != nil {
return -1, err
}
recv := make([]byte, 1024)
_, err = conn.Read(recv)
if err != nil {
return -1, err
}
end := time.Now()
return end.Sub(start), nil
}
func Ping(lk *vmess.Link, count int, totalTimeout, eachTimeout time.Duration) (*ping.Status, error) {
ps := &ping.Status{
Durations: &ping.DurationList{},
}
icmp, err := getICMP()
if err != nil {
return ps, err
}
ip, err := net.ResolveIPAddr("ip", lk.Add)
if err != nil {
return ps, err
}
timeout := make(chan bool, 1)
go func() {
time.Sleep(totalTimeout * time.Second)
timeout <- true
}()
L:
for round := 0; round < count; round++ {
chDelay := make(chan time.Duration)
go func() {
delay, err := sendICMPRequest(icmp, ip, eachTimeout)
if err != nil {
ps.ErrCounter++
}
chDelay <- delay
}()
select {
case delay := <-chDelay:
if delay > 0 {
*ps.Durations = append(*ps.Durations, ping.Duration(delay))
}
case <-timeout:
break L
}
}
return ps, nil
}
func checkSum(data []byte) uint16 {
var (
sum uint32
length = len(data)
index int
)
for length > 1 {
sum += uint32(data[index])<<8 + uint32(data[index+1])
index += 2
length -= 2
}
if length > 0 {
sum += uint32(data[index])
}
sum += sum >> 16
return uint16(^sum)
}
